Alina Shcherbinina enters this ITF W15 Irvine semifinal on outdoor hard courts with significant momentum after claiming her first professional title last week in Los Angeles, where she defeated Kaitlyn Carnicella in a three-set final following strong qualifying and main-draw wins. The Baylor alum has posted efficient recent results, including a straight-sets quarterfinal victory here over Isabella Marton. Midori Castillo Meza, the No. 7 seed from Mexico and Arizona college player, advanced by edging No. 4 seed Alexis Nguyen in a tight two-setter but lacks comparable recent title-winning form. Traders view Shcherbinina’s hot streak and hard-court results as the dominant factor in current pricing, though Castillo Meza’s seeding and experience in lower-tier events provide realistic upset potential if the favorite’s serving or movement falters.

This market will resolve to 'Alina Shcherbinina' if Alina Shcherbinina advances against Midori Castillo Meza.
This market will resolve to 'Midori Castillo Meza' if Midori Castillo Meza advances against Alina Shcherbinina.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source will be official information from the International Tennis Federation (ITF). A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
